Handover Note — From Director Ilsa Marrow to Director Ben Copeland

The new Meridian tier of our Quillbase subscription launches next month. Pricing, entitlement rules, and the migration path for existing Standard customers are documented in the shared launch pack. Sales leads should complete enablement before outreach begins, and log all upgrade conversations carefully. Please review the confidential note appended below before briefing your teams.

internal memo for kaguf-yajog: Headcount on the Druath team goes from 30 to 70 by the end of November. Gross margin on Druath came in at 56 percent against a plan of 28 percent.

## Deployment

Quellhorn is our on-call alert deduplicator. It sits between the monitoring pipeline and the paging gateway, collapsing duplicate alerts within a sliding window so responders see one page per incident rather than dozens. Deploy it as a single stateless replica per region; the dedup window state lives in the shared cache, so restarts are safe at any time. New team members should deploy to staging first and watch the suppression-rate dashboard for an hour. The staging deployment expects the following configuration values.

config for kafof-bawef:
holath:
  log_level: debug
  metrics_host: metrics.holath.qorvelsys.internal
  pin: 2191
  pool_size: 32

### Changelog — Quillpad Wiki v3.8.2

- Rotated the publishing key after role-based access overhaul.
- `editor` role no longer inherits `admin-export`; split into `wiki-read` and `wiki-publish`.
- Deploy pipeline now checks role claims before signing page bundles.
- Old key revoked effective this release; mirrors on Farrowgate cluster updated.
- Reviewers: confirm the ACL migration script matches the matrix in `roles.yaml`.

The replacement deploy key for the publish pipeline follows.

release key, fahaf-bajof: bky3_Xam